Furnished condos are great rental options for those who move frequently, are between housing arrangements, or are looking for a secondary residence. With a furnished rental, you won't have to purchase or move furniture before settling into your new place. However, there are a few things to consider when looking for a furnished condo in Longwood.
There are a few different types of furnished rentals you should be familiar with. A fully furnished rental, often called a turnkey rental, comes with everything you need, right down to the silverware, linens, and towels. A furnished rental usually provides furniture like a couch, beds, a coffee table, a dining table and chairs, and kitchen appliances. It will also include various décor items, such as lamps and mirrors. A semi-furnished rental contains only essential furniture and appliances.
A furnished condo typically costs a bit more than an unfurnished condo. The property owner will consider things like convenience and wear and tear when pricing the unit. They'll likely have to replace some furniture when you move out, so they'll work that into the rent price. Overall, you can expect to pay about forty percent more than you would for an unfurnished condo. You could also encounter higher security deposits.
